piperada vasca with idiazabal - eggs with sheep's cheese

Yield
4 servings
MeasureIngredient
4 tablespoons Extra-virgin olive oil
20  Mixed piquillo and anaheim chilies; cut 2" batons,
  Seeds removed
1 medium Red onion; thinly sliced
Plum tomatoes; chopped 1/2" dice
  With seeds and juice
12 ounces Sl bacon; cut 1" batons
Eggs
4 slices Jamon Serrano or Jambon de Bayonne
4 slices Idiazabal cheese
4 slices Baguette -; (ea 1" thick)

Preheat oven to 425 degrees. In a 10-inch saute pan, heat oil until, smoking. Add peppers, onion, garlic and bacon and cook until very soft, about 12 to 14 minutes. Add tomatoes and cook 2 minutes. Beat the eggs and pour into pan, stirring only once to distribute peppers. Cook slowly 2 to 3 minutes and place in oven 2 minutes. Meanwhile, place 1 piece of Jamon on each plate. Place Idiazabal cheese on baguette slices and place on pan in oven. When eggs are set and cheese has melted, remove both pans from oven.

Spoon eggs over Jamon and serve toast on side. This recipe yields 4 servings.

Comments: The original recipe title as listed is "Piperada Vasca With Idiazabal - Scrambled Egg Custard With Sheep's Cheese".
